Output 2e18a0558d9fc3345ca6a6dd307961eb4594f990c1a9e1ff4da4a7c48c503480:5

value
32490286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f4cf2497df7eb9c28f215dc4f582c26d0470e05 OP_EQUAL
address
34YX3peyrE6W881Cp5g7VVkaNgrkfvExXe
transaction
2e18a0558d9fc3345ca6a6dd307961eb4594f990c1a9e1ff4da4a7c48c503480
confirmations
214594
spent
true